So the master ( Primary ) account has a Playstation Plus membership with 11 months left to go before expiration.
Why isn't my local profile on the same Playstation 4 system getting any multiplayer benefits if no settings have been changed? I've been playing for 2 weeks and suddenly it doesn't work.
Any help would be lovely.
Best Answer
For any secondary (i.e. non PS+) accounts to benefit, the PS+ account must of set this system as the primary system.
This is achieved via the instructions on the playstation site

Is PS Plus necessary?
In order to play most PS4 and PS5 games in online multiplayer, you need to have a PlayStation Plus subscription. Some games don't require a subscription, check PlayStation\u2122Store to see if PlayStation Plus is required for online play.What happens if you try to play online without PS Plus?
Any game in PlayStation Now can be played online without an active PlayStation Plus membership. You can think of this as an extra perk of a PS Now subscription. However, if you want to transfer your PS Now game saves from console over to PC for whatever reason, you will need a PS Plus membership to do so.Can I play PS+ games without PS+?
